Germany’s Unfortunate Decision

The hodl strategy — involving long-term accumulation and retention of Bitcoin investments — benefited BTC investors in 2024 as market prices soared above $100,000 in December. Germany was one of the larger Bitcoin holders that made a costly decision to sell 50,000 BTC in July 2024.

Government’s Unfortunate Decision

Germany sold about 49,858 Bitcoin between June 19 and July 12 for roughly 2.6 billion euros ($2.8 billion). The German government had ordered the ’emergency sales’ of seized Bitcoin in June under the impression that the cryptocurrency’s value might drop by more than 10%. Unfortunately for Germany’s price analysts, Bitcoin hit a new all-time high six months later, which would have brought the value of the 50,000 BTC to over $5 billion.

Panic Selling: A Costly Mistake

The decision to panic sell Bitcoin proved disastrous to the German government. Countries like Bhutan and El Salvador continued to invest and hold onto their Bitcoin holdings, earning millions of dollars in unrealized gains.

Crypto ATM Installations Flatline

While an uptick in Bitcoin and cryptocurrency ATM installations is not a direct indicator of crypto adoption, the ecosystem helps reduce the proximity between digital assets and the end-user. Regulators globally have been actively cracking down on Bitcoin ATMs in an attempt to prevent bad actors from duping investors, hiding stolen assets or laundering money.

Regulatory Challenges

On the other hand, major economies are promoting the installation of crypto ATMs to stay ahead of the innovation curve. As a result, the overall growth of the crypto ATM ecosystem worldwide flatlined in 2024. In January, the global crypto ATM network comprised roughly 36,500 machines, which by the year-end grew to 38,600 machines.

Despite Challenges, Growth Continues

Despite countries like Australia doubling their ATM network to nearly 1,400 machines in 2024, the total number of global ATMs has remained stagnant since 2022 at an average of 38,000 machines. Clearer regulations and operational licenses in the coming year are expected to improve the crypto ATM landscape and encourage more installations.

Regulatory Challenges: India’s GST Tax Collection

India has expressed issues with the tax collection process implemented by several crypto exchanges. In total, 17 crypto exchanges, including Binance, WazirX and CoinDCX, were flagged for non-payment and collection of goods and services tax (GST) taxes. Cumulatively, crypto exchanges in India owe $97 million to the Indian government in unpaid GST taxes.

Binance Executives Face Litigation

Top Binance executives — Binance founder and former CEO Changpeng ‘CZ’ Zhao and the company’s compliance officer Tigran Gambaryan — were dragged into legal battles with authorities this year. CZ admitted to violating the Bank Secrecy Act (BSA) and failing to implement an effective Anti-Money Laundering (AML) program at Binance.
